Perth’s electronic trio Crooked Colours with Phil Slabber, Leon De Baughn, and Liam Merret-Park, are in the middle of their national tour in support for their single, Capricious,  off the band’s forthcoming sophomore EP due later this year.

Happy: Who are your musical influences?

CC: Whoever’s bringing out epic new music!! SBTRKT’s new album is a perfect example.

Happy:  What’s the story behind Capricious?

CC: We wanted to make something that was dark and brooding and at the same time would be super fun to play live, something that would hit hard in a dark clubby type of environment.

Happy: What can people expect from your live show?

CC: We run a few synths, guitar, live drums on stage. We keep it as high energy as possible. Party vibes!!

Happy: What’s next for Crooked Colours after the tour?

CC: We’ve got a busy summer of shows coming up but apart from that we want to get away and start writing some new material for the album.

Happy:  What can people expect from your sophomore EP?

CC: Keeping with the same vibe as Capricious.
